Summary

"Clear Crystals" by Clara Frances McKee Beede is a collection of poems expressing a wide range of emotions during the mid-20th century. Heavily inspired by the backdrop of World War II, the poems explore significant themes such as love, loss, hope, and the complexities of being human amid such a tumultuous period. Through various verses, the author captures the spirit of the time, reflecting gratitude, longing for peace, and the strong bonds between soldiers and their families. The work also celebrates simple joys and reflects on the passage of time, highlighting the resilience of the human spirit even when faced with difficulties. The collection serves as a powerful glimpse into the emotional atmosphere of the era.
